Building a Legendary Crew
Roger’s journey from a promising young pirate to the most powerful man on the seas was defined by his ability to gather a crew of extraordinary individuals. Each member was a force of nature, a vital component in the Roger Pirates’ unmatched strength.
One of the most important figures in the crew was Silvers Rayleigh. He became the captain’s right-hand man. Rayleigh possessed an unparalleled understanding of navigation, combat, and the deeper mysteries of the sea. His strength was legendary.
Then there was Shanks, a young apprentice who would later become a Yonko. His influence would touch the lives of many, including the protagonist, Monkey D. Luffy.
Buggy the Clown was another crew member, though he would later take a less dignified path. Even Buggy was instrumental to the Roger Pirates’ survival, demonstrating the crew’s varied strengths.
These individuals, and others, formed a formidable crew, bound by a shared love of adventure and loyalty to their captain. Together, they faced down countless enemies, navigated treacherous waters, and challenged the established order of the world. Their bond and shared experiences molded them into a legendary force. The camaraderie of the Roger Pirates became a symbol of strength and unity.

Facing the Inevitable
Roger’s decision to surrender to the Marines is one of the most enigmatic moments in the story. His choice raised many questions and speculation about his reasons. Why would the most powerful man on the seas give himself up? The answer lies, in part, in his incurable illness, a disease that steadily eroded his strength and vitality. Knowing that his time was limited, Roger made a momentous decision. It was a calculated choice that would set events into motion.
He chose to surrender himself to the Marines, and what he did next would shock the world. His capture was not a defeat; it was a calculated act to set in motion his final design. He knew he was on borrowed time and wanted to ensure his legacy would continue, that his dream would be carried on by others.
The Execution That Changed Everything
His execution at Loguetown would be a watershed moment. As the executioner raised his blade, Roger, with a smile on his face, uttered his final words: “My treasure? You want it? I’ll let you know how to get it! I left everything I gathered together in one place! Now you just have to find it!”
These words were not just the dying declaration of a pirate king; they were the catalyst that ignited the Great Pirate Era. His execution was not a moment of defeat but a moment of creation. His final words became a challenge, a promise, and an invitation to the world’s dreamers.
The impact of Gol D. Roger’s words was immediate and far-reaching. The oceans exploded with the energy of countless pirates seeking to claim the treasure and become the next Pirate King. His last words became a call to adventure, echoing through the hearts of every sailor and dreamer.

The Mysteries That Remain
The influence of Roger on the *One Piece* world is enormous. His story is the fuel that drives the core storyline. The mysteries of the Void Century, the Will of D., and the meaning of the One Piece are all tied to him.
The Void Century, a hidden period of history, is a treasure trove of mysteries that Roger learned. His knowledge and understanding of the events that transpired are an important part of the overall plot.
The Will of D. is a thread that connects Roger to other key characters. His story is tied to the broader themes of the *One Piece* world.
The One Piece, itself, is the ultimate mystery, the object of desire, and the key to unlocking the series’ final secrets. Its true nature remains a mystery, adding to the allure of Roger’s story.
